The Coldest Girl in Coldtown by Holly Black
They should really think of changing the title of this book to the ‘Stupidest Girl in Coldtown’ Because throughout the course of this book the main character does nothing but make bad decisions and then complain that she keeps making bad decisions. I was expecting her to be more buffyish and take charge and not just dumb and annoying. This novel is filled with all your standard vampire clichés and tropes, so if you are looking for something new and original then you had better look elsewhere.
This was a tough read. There are some badly worded and awkward sentences at the beginning and it can be difficult going at times because the main girl will annoy you constantly.
The two main characters Tanya and her ex-boyfriend start off well written and developed but they get progressively more unrealistic as the book goes on. The rest of the characters are all the standard one dimensional over exaggerated horror types. The villains are all ruthless and unredeemable, the good guys honest and virtuous.
Overall I’d give this book a miss unless you are really looking for a teeny vampire book.
My Rating 1.5 out of 5
